TICKET: Upgrade Larkspur broker to v9. Dual-run old/new clusters for 48h, mirror traffic, compare ack latency. Consumers on the Tindale fleet need the new client lib first. Rollback is snapshot restore, under 10 min. Blocking weekly sync sign-off until soak passes. The candidate build is identified by the token below.

pipeline stamp: htk3_a71

**Q: Does the string-extraction script touch anything sensitive?**

Short answer: no. The `lexiharvest` script only scans source files for translatable strings and writes them to a flat catalog. It never reads env vars, config secrets, or network resources — it's pure static parsing. Mira from the Polyglot team audited it last quarter. The full threat-model writeup and audit notes live on our internal wiki page.

wiki page, yafop-fadup: https://jira.qorvelsys.internal/projects/display/projects/pages

# Ledgerloop loyalty-points ledger — local env
# Reviewer notes: points accrual runs double-entry, so don't touch the
# BALANCE_MODE flag unless you enjoy reconciliation tickets. Redis cache
# settings below are safe defaults for dev. The ledger API refuses to
# boot without its write credential, which gets appended immediately
# after this comment block ends, on the very next line.

sealed setting: VAULT_KEY20=c8ea1e419912889df6b4

### RestockPilot: Release Prerequisites

Before cutting a release, confirm that the RestockPilot planner can reach the SnackGrid inventory service, since the build pipeline runs an integration smoke test against staging during packaging. A failed handshake here blocks the release tag, so verify credentials first. The pipeline reads its staging credential from the deploy config; for reference and manual verification, the current key appears below.

service key, tajof-fawip: vxb4-JNOz

# Build Provenance: Thumbpress Queue

For the weekly sync. Every artifact in the Thumbpress thumbnail generation queue is built from a pinned commit on release branches only — no local builds deployed, ever. Provenance attestations are generated at build time and checked at deploy by the gatekeeper job. If an image lacks an attestation, the queue refuses to schedule it. Verification takes seconds; disputes go to the platform rotation. Current production image was cut Tuesday; its build token is recorded below.

pipeline stamp: htk4_b7f3